| Item | food & drinks | fuel | rent | building project | education | savings |
| Percentage% | 35 | 7.5 | 1.0 | 15 | 17.5 | x |
The table shows the monthly expenditure (in percentages) of Mr. Okafor's salary.
(a) Calculate the percentage of Mr. Okafor's salary that was put into savings.
(b) Illustrate the information on a pie chart.
(c) If Mr. Okafor's annual gross salary is $28,800.00 and he pays tax of 12%.
Calculate; (i) his monthly tax; (ii) the amount saved each month.
